Full Stack Python Developer

Location: Atlanta, GA

Job Type: contract

Company: IDR

Category: Development and Architecture

Job Description Apply Now

**IDR is seeking a Full Stack Python Developer to join one of our top clients for an opportunity in Atlanta, Georgia.** This role involves working in a dynamic environment focused on modern web development within a government agency's IT infrastructure. The position offers a chance to contribute to significant public sector projects, utilizing your full stack development skills.**Position Overview for the Full Stack Python Developer:** - Develop and maintain both front-end and back-end components of web applications utilizing a variety of modern frameworks and languages. -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design scalable, secure, and high-performance solutions. - Contribute to the full application lifecycle, including requirements gathering, design, development, testing, and deployment. - Work within a Microsoft .NET environment, with a heavy emphasis on Linux servers and cloud services. - Provide expertise in front-end development (HTML, CSS, JavaScript, React, Angular, Vue.js) and back-end development (Python, Node.js, .NET).**Requirements for the Full Stack Python Developer:** - Minimum 5 years of experience in Full Stack Developer or similar role. - Strong proficiency in front-end languages and frameworks such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, React, Angular, Vue.js. - Solid experience with back-end languages and frameworks including Python, Node.js, Ruby, Java, PHP, or .NET. - Familiarity with database technologies such as MySQL, PostgreSQL, or MongoDB. - Experience with version control systems like Git and understanding of RESTful API design and implementation.**What's in it for you?** - Competitive compensation package - Full Benefits; Medical, Vision, Dental, and more! - Opportunity to get in with an industry leading organization.**Why IDR?** - 25+ Years of Proven Industry Experience in 4 major markets - Employee Stock Ownership Program - Dedicated Engagement Manager who is committed to you and your success. - Medical, Dental, Vision, and Life Insurance - ClearlyRated's Best of Staffing® Client and Talent Award winner 12 years in a row.
